Cox Earns First Career Athlete Of The Week Honors From The G-MAC

INDIANAPOLIS, IND. - Emily Cox was named Softball Pitcher of the Week by the Great Midwest Athletic Conference (G-MAC) this week, Monday (April 1). This is Cox's first career Athlete of the Week honor and the third for a softball player this season.

Cox's dominant season continued last week, going 3-0 as a starter with wins over Malone (March 25), Trevecca Nazarene (March 29), and Kentucky Wesleyan (March 30). The senior went nearly unblemished during the Timberwolves' 10-0 rout of KWC, throwing a no-hitter which was NU's first since March 5, 2022, versus Wayne St. (Neb.). She totaled 19 IP with three complete games while allowing just four earned runs and striking out 20.

She has now won 10 starts in a row and holds an 11-1 record with a 1.05 ERA en route named to the 2024 Tucci/ NFCA Pitcher of the Year Watchlist on Thursday (March 28).

Northwood softball is currently 22-11 overall and 9-3 in the G-MAC and is set to host Cedarville Friday (April 5) in a doubleheader beginning at 2 p.m.
